Question

What we do get from cereals, pulses, fruits and vegetables?

Solution

We get different nutrients from cereals, pulses, fruits, and vegetables that are very essential for the growth of an individual.
(i) Cereals are a rich source of carbohydrates. They include wheat, rice, maize, etc.
(ii) Pulses provide large amount of proteins. They include lentil, black gram, pigeon pea, etc.
(iii) Fruits are a good source of vitamins, minerals, roughage, proteins, carbohydrates, and fats. They include apple, mango, banana, etc.
(iv) Vegetables are good source of vitamins and minerals. They also provide roughage, proteins, carbohydrates, and fats. They include potato, spinach, onion, etc.
